orcal数据库连接是什么
-
Orcal数据库连接是指与Oracle数据库建立连接的过程和方法。Oracle数据库是一种关系型数据库管理系统,广泛应用于企业级应用程序中。要与Oracle数据库进行交互,需要先建立数据库连接,然后才能执行数据库操作,如查询、插入、更新和删除数据等。
以下是关于Oracle数据库连接的五个要点:
-
JDBC连接:Java应用程序可以使用JDBC(Java Database Connectivity)来连接Oracle数据库。JDBC提供了一组API,用于与不同的数据库建立连接和执行数据库操作。通过加载数据库驱动程序并使用URL、用户名和密码等信息,可以建立与Oracle数据库的连接。
-
ODBC连接:ODBC(Open Database Connectivity)是一种面向C/C++应用程序的数据库连接标准。可以使用ODBC驱动程序来连接Oracle数据库。通过ODBC连接Oracle数据库时,需要配置数据源名称(DSN)和用户名密码等信息。
-
Oracle客户端连接:Oracle提供了一组客户端工具,如SQL*Plus和SQL Developer,用于连接和管理Oracle数据库。这些客户端工具可以直接在本地计算机上安装,并提供图形用户界面和命令行界面,使用户可以轻松地连接到Oracle数据库。
-
连接字符串:连接字符串是连接Oracle数据库时使用的字符串,包含了连接所需的信息,如主机名、端口号、服务名、用户名和密码等。连接字符串的格式根据不同的连接方式和驱动程序而有所不同。
-
连接池:连接池是一种用于管理数据库连接的技术。连接池可以预先创建一定数量的数据库连接,并将其保存在池中。当应用程序需要连接数据库时,可以从连接池中获取一个可用的连接,使用完后再将其放回池中。连接池可以提高应用程序的性能和可伸缩性,减少连接的创建和销毁开销。
以上是关于Oracle数据库连接的基本介绍。根据具体的应用场景和需求,可以选择适合的连接方式和技术来连接Oracle数据库。
1年前 -
-
Orcale数据库连接是指在应用程序中连接和访问Orcale数据库的过程。Orcale是一种关系型数据库管理系统(RDBMS),广泛用于企业级应用程序和数据管理。在应用程序中使用Orcale数据库时,需要建立数据库连接,以便与数据库进行交互。
数据库连接通常由以下几个关键组成部分构成:
-
数据库驱动程序(Database Driver):数据库驱动程序是用于与数据库进行通信的软件组件。对于Orcale数据库,通常使用Orcale提供的JDBC驱动程序来建立数据库连接。JDBC(Java Database Connectivity)是Java平台上用于连接和操作各种关系型数据库的标准API。
-
连接字符串(Connection String):连接字符串是包含连接数据库所需信息的字符串。它通常包括数据库的地址、端口号、数据库名称、用户名和密码等。根据具体的应用程序和数据库环境的不同,连接字符串的格式和内容也会有所不同。
-
连接对象(Connection Object):连接对象是在应用程序中表示与数据库建立的连接的对象。通过连接对象,应用程序可以执行数据库操作,如查询、插入、更新和删除等。连接对象提供了一系列方法和属性,用于管理数据库连接和执行数据库操作。
-
数据库连接池(Database Connection Pool):数据库连接池是一种用于管理数据库连接的技术。它可以在应用程序启动时创建一定数量的数据库连接,并将这些连接保存在连接池中。当应用程序需要连接数据库时,可以从连接池中获取一个可用的连接,用完后再将连接返回到连接池中。数据库连接池可以提高应用程序的性能和可扩展性,避免频繁地创建和关闭数据库连接。
在应用程序中建立Orcale数据库连接的步骤如下:
-
加载数据库驱动程序:在应用程序中加载Orcale的JDBC驱动程序,以便能够使用JDBC API进行数据库操作。
-
构建连接字符串:根据数据库的地址、端口号、数据库名称、用户名和密码等信息,构建连接字符串。
-
建立数据库连接:使用连接字符串创建一个连接对象,并通过连接对象建立与数据库的连接。
-
执行数据库操作:通过连接对象执行需要的数据库操作,如查询、插入、更新和删除等。
-
关闭数据库连接:在应用程序不再需要与数据库交互时,应关闭数据库连接,以释放资源。
总结:
Orcale数据库连接是在应用程序中与Orcale数据库建立连接的过程。通过加载数据库驱动程序、构建连接字符串、建立数据库连接和执行数据库操作等步骤,应用程序可以连接到Orcale数据库,并进行相应的数据库操作。数据库连接池可以提高应用程序的性能和可扩展性。
1年前 -
-
Oracle数据库连接是指建立应用程序与Oracle数据库之间的通信连接,以便应用程序能够访问和操作数据库中的数据。在进行数据库连接之前,需要提供正确的连接信息,包括数据库的主机名、端口号、数据库实例名、用户名和密码等。
下面是Oracle数据库连接的操作流程:
-
导入Oracle驱动程序:首先需要在应用程序的类路径中导入Oracle数据库的驱动程序。这可以通过下载适用于所使用的Java开发工具的Oracle JDBC驱动程序,并将其添加到项目的构建路径中来实现。
-
加载驱动程序:在应用程序的代码中,使用
Class.forName()方法加载Oracle驱动程序。例如:
Class.forName("oracle.jdbc.driver.OracleDriver");- 建立连接:使用
DriverManager.getConnection()方法建立与Oracle数据库的连接。需要提供正确的连接信息,包括数据库的主机名、端口号、数据库实例名、用户名和密码等。例如:
Connection connection = DriverManager.getConnection("jdbc:oracle:thin:@hostname:port:SID", "username", "password");其中,
jdbc:oracle:thin:@hostname:port:SID是连接字符串,其中hostname是数据库的主机名,port是数据库的端口号,SID是数据库的实例名。- 执行SQL语句:连接成功后,可以使用
Connection对象创建Statement对象,并使用Statement对象执行SQL语句。例如:
Statement statement = connection.createStatement(); ResultSet resultSet = statement.executeQuery("SELECT * FROM table_name");这里的
table_name是要查询的表名。- 处理结果:根据需要,可以使用
ResultSet对象获取查询结果,并对结果进行处理。例如:
while (resultSet.next()) { // 处理每一行的数据 String column1 = resultSet.getString("column1"); int column2 = resultSet.getInt("column2"); // ... }- 关闭连接:在完成数据库操作后,需要关闭与Oracle数据库的连接,释放资源。可以使用
Connection对象的close()方法实现。例如:
connection.close();以上就是Oracle数据库连接的基本操作流程。根据具体的应用需求,还可以使用连接池、事务管理等技术来优化连接的使用。
1年前 -